Output d331a545c4e038ef6a85286f72ec01505d938f36298a4284db52b5ee964ca5ed:1

value
1073000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576da80c661f31789118ccf95927ee21d5af0bb8 OP_EQUAL
address
39fJ5J7tHQ6w3e2pFSyFZpSVDDkLwfzaEU
transaction
d331a545c4e038ef6a85286f72ec01505d938f36298a4284db52b5ee964ca5ed
spent
true